Insight Partners experienced a data breach in January due to a sophisticated social engineering attack, first detected on January 16. The private equity and venture capital firm reported unauthorized access to its information systems but did not disclose specific data affected. The company acted swiftly to contain the breach, notify stakeholders, and involve law enforcement. While no operational disruptions occurred, Insight is investigating the incident with third-party cybersecurity experts. The firm emphasized that there should be no material impact on its portfolio companies or stakeholders. Insight Partners has invested in over 800 companies, primarily in IT and software sectors.
